Early Beginnings
Understanding the roots of AF-Aviation helps appreciate its journey.
- Founded in 1933: AF-Aviation, originally known as Air France, was established in 1933 through the merger of several smaller airlines.
- First Flight: The airline's inaugural flight took off from Paris to London, marking the beginning of its international operations.
- World War II Impact: During World War II, AF-Aviation's operations were significantly disrupted, but it managed to resume services shortly after the war ended.

Global Reach
AF-Aviation's extensive network connects people across the globe.
- Over 200 Destinations: The airline serves more than 200 destinations in 94 countries, making it one of the most globally connected airlines.
- SkyTeam Alliance: As a founding member of the SkyTeam alliance, AF-Aviation partners with other major airlines to offer seamless travel experiences.
- Hub at Charles de Gaulle: Paris Charles de Gaulle Airport serves as the primary hub, facilitating easy connections for international travelers.
